Transaction 7988dd0150ab4c7a3de28b041c88381621301b4399274f540e11740c91382d37
2 Input
1 Outputs
- 7988dd0150ab4c7a3de28b041c88381621301b4399274f540e11740c91382d37:0
value 449900000
address 1KqQAwCT79X4kW3DkoghWwLu9Q8RGEKy5U